In talking with the folks at Nokian, they pointed out that snow tires are really for snow - the type of stuff you get in real snowy (think upper Canada) climates. For "normal" environments - think Chicago and New York, a snow tire is actually detrimental to your driving 95% of the time. Meaning, if there is not snow on the road (which 90% of the time there is not), you are using the wrong tire - snow tires are terrible at turning and stopping in dry environments. So.. enter the Nokian WRG3 - technically an all season, but still really good in the white stuff. In a perfect world, you would have this for Nov - April 15 and a summer tire for the rest of the time. Ok, now we are completely off topic - sorry!
